Output d70ec007e8c566c4ba0f906083a3a7896cf8cfc961494a07a82ce7177cb45265:173

value
713815
script pubkey
OP_0 OP_PUSHBYTES_20 b8fef125957f10733ccdf8952ff245522972a20a
address
bc1qhrl0zfv40ug8x0xdlz2jluj92g5h9gs2a9fmx2
transaction
d70ec007e8c566c4ba0f906083a3a7896cf8cfc961494a07a82ce7177cb45265
spent
true